Lines Matching full:overlap
317 * regions that are unsafe to overlap with during decompression, and other
395 * Avoid the region that is unsafe to overlap during in mem_avoid_init()
433 * Does this memory vector overlap a known avoided area? If so, record the
434 * overlap region with the lowest address.
437 struct mem_vector *overlap) in mem_avoid_overlap() argument
447 *overlap = mem_avoid[i]; in mem_avoid_overlap()
448 earliest = overlap->start; in mem_avoid_overlap()
462 *overlap = avoid; in mem_avoid_overlap()
463 earliest = overlap->start; in mem_avoid_overlap()
473 *overlap = avoid; in mem_avoid_overlap()
474 earliest = overlap->start; in mem_avoid_overlap()
588 struct mem_vector region, overlap; in __process_mem_region() local
612 if (!mem_avoid_overlap(®ion, &overlap)) { in __process_mem_region()
618 if (overlap.start >= region.start + image_size) { in __process_mem_region()
619 region.size = overlap.start - region.start; in __process_mem_region()
624 region.start = overlap.start + overlap.size; in __process_mem_region()